Job summary

A leading technology company in Ottawa is looking for an experienced FPGA Developer to create cutting-edge broadcast video processing technology. You will architect, design, simulate, and test FPGA solutions, working closely with cross-functional teams. Ideal candidates will have over 6 years of experience, in-depth knowledge of Verilog, and a collaborative mindset. The role includes flexible hours, generous paid time off, and a vibrant working environment.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 6 years FPGA development experience with expertise in Video/Audio technologies preferred.
  • In-depth knowledge of (System)Verilog.
  • Expert in FPGA workflow including RTL design capture, synthesis, timing closure.

Responsibilities

  • Architect, design, simulate and test leading edge SoC FPGA solutions.
  • Lead the overall FPGA delivery collaborating with cross-functional teams.
  • Participate in Agile Scrum ceremonies.
